Craigslist is a large-scale free classified advertising website on the Internet, and a leader in classified information websites. The classified information on the website includes job recruitment, house rental and sale, second-hand product trading, housekeeping, entertainment, and sensitive search for opposite-sex friends. All information is published freely and for free. Alexa ranking 109 (March 2018) Nature Advertising website Founded in 1995 Website Craigslist.org Founder Craig Newmark Headquarters San Francisco, California, USAintroduceFounded in 1995, Craigslist has been operating for 20 years and is still a small team operating semi-commercially. It was not until 2014 that Craigslist opened up advertising in areas such as automobiles, which led to a significant increase in revenue. Consulting firm AIM Group estimates that Craigslist's revenue in 2014 reached $335 million. In addition to serving the United States, we have also opened special edition services in hundreds of cities in nearly 100 countries around the world. The website divides services into several categories, including community, housing, work, dating, sales, etc., and users can also post resumes and performance information. markCraigslist has a user flagging system that allows for quick identification of illegal and inappropriate postings. Users may flag posts that they believe violate Craigslist guidelines. Reporting does not require an account login or registration, and can be done anonymously by anyone. When a certain number of users flag a post, it is automatically deleted. Adult services controversyOn May 13, 2009, Craigslist announced that it would shut down its Porn Services section and replace it with an Adult Services section, which would be moderated by Craigslist employees. On September 4, 2010, Craigslist closed the adult services section of its website in the United States. On September 8, 2010, the "censored" tag and its dead link to adult services were completely removed. On September 15, 2011, Craigslist announced that it had shut down its adult service in the United States, however, it defended its right to carry such ads. On Dec. 19, 2010, under pressure from Ottawa and several provinces, Craigslist shut down the listings for "erotic services" and "adult performances" from its Canadian site, even though prostitution itself was not illegal in Canada at the time. In January 2006, the San Francisco Bay Guardian published an editorial claiming that Craigslist could threaten the business of local alternative newspapers. As of 2012, mashup sites such as padmapper.com and housingmaps.com overlay Craigslist data with Google Maps and add their own search filters for improved usability. In June 2012, Craigslist changed its terms of service to prohibit the practice.
